Tag Icons

Ich habe das Problem schon seit einiger Zeit: Das Tag-Symbol wird in der Themenansicht in größeren Header-Tag-Symbolen angezeigt:

Screenshot von TCs Vorschau:

1 „Gefällt mir“

Core hat eine Regel, die speziell das Haus-Symbol erhöht:

image

Sie können sie überschreiben, indem Sie Folgendes verwenden:

.d-header .discourse-tags .d-icon-house {
    font-size: var(--font-0);
}
5 „Gefällt mir“

Oh, interessant. Ich glaube, die Kernregel ist vorhanden, wenn das Haus-Symbol als Website-Logo verwendet wird. Wir könnten den Kern aktualisieren, um die Spezifität zu erhöhen und das Logo-Symbol anzusprechen, wodurch die Tag-/Kategorie-Symbole unberührt bleiben.

5 „Gefällt mir“

Mir ist aufgefallen, dass die Symbole an 2 Stellen nicht angezeigt werden: im Dropdown-Menü und im Tag-Banner

@Arkshine @pmusaraj Zu Ihrer Information, wir haben gerade dasselbe Problem im Suchmodal reproduziert. Aber Ihr CSS-Workaround hat es auch behoben :heart:

1 „Gefällt mir“

aus irgendeinem Grund war dieses Override-CSS seit 3.6.0.beta1 nicht mehr ausreichend.

Ich habe es wie folgt angepasst und es hat funktioniert:

.d-header .search-result-tag .d-icon-house {
    font-size: var(--font-0);
}
2 „Gefällt mir“

@tobiaseigen @Lilly Könntet ihr bitte eine Option hinzufügen, um ein Standard-Tag-Symbol für alle Tags festzulegen, die kein spezifisches Symbol haben?

Außerdem wäre eine Integration mit Tag Banners großartig.

3 „Gefällt mir“

Das ist eine schöne Idee, Hyteller! Ich bin kein Programmierer und habe diese Befugnis daher nicht, aber wenn du es in einem neuen #feature-Thema vorschlägst, könnten wir diskutieren, wie das aussehen könnte, und es könnte vom Team in Betracht gezogen werden. Es wäre schön, wenn du von deiner Seite aus mehr Details darüber liefern könntest, warum du denkst, dass es eine gute Idee ist.

Ich persönlich würde es begrüßen, wenn Tag-Symbole in den Kern von Discourse integriert würden, anstatt sie als Theme-Komponente hinzufügen zu müssen.

Willkommen in unserer Community! :sunflower:

3 „Gefällt mir“